av8tr Posted August 26, 2018 Report Share Posted August 26, 2018 I have one, but I don't need any parts. Ammo is a problem. I have found some 7.65 French long form Buffalo Arms. But the problem is they use a jacketed bullet with an exposed a soft lead nose. I would get FTF after a few rounds, due to the soft lead hitting the feed ramp and deforming. DZelenka Posted August 27, 2018 Report Share Posted August 27, 2018 Question,- is the 7.65 French long the same as the 30 cal pedersen cartridge.???Can they be made from 32 H&R long brass??Jim CDimensionally they are extremely close. However, the .30 Pederson has a slight bevel on the rim. This caused feeding issues with the Pederson Device we were shooting at the range.
